The virtual 2023 MOSS Meetup is an online gathering designed for library staff from Idaho’s colleges and universities. Taking place over two-half days May 2nd and 3rd, the Meetup is an opportunity to exchange ideas and discover a variety of perspectives, discuss shared problems and brainstorm solutions, and develop new ideas to bring back to your libraries.

Our theme this year is access: ‘Equality of access to recorded knowledge and information’ is one of the core values of librarianship. Access can take many forms, such as physical access to library buildings and access to digital resources available online. In order to promote access, academic libraries offer a variety of services and resources. Access also encompasses issues of equity and inclusivity, such as ensuring that library materials and services are available to all members of the community.
